Clifford Chance Badea has advised French investment fund AEW on the sale of the America House office building in Bucharest to the real estate investment division of Morgan Stanley and a group of Israeli investors represented by David Hay and the Promenada Mall Targu Mures to Hungary's Indotek Group. Tuca Zbarcea & Asociatii advised the buyers on the first deal and Biris Goran advised the buyers on the second.

Clifford Chance Badea describes AEW, which is owned by French financial group Natixis, as "one of the largest real estate investment managers in the world." According to the firm, AEW "entered the Romanian market in 2007, through the acquisition of America House from Globe Trade Center and, a few months later, the acquisition of Promenada Mall Targu Mures from BelRom."

The Clifford Chance team included Partner Nadia Badea, Counsels Andreea Sisman and Mihai Macelaru, Senior Associate Radu Costin, and Lawyers Madalina Mailat and Bogdan Micu.

Editor's Note: After this article was published Biris Goran announced that its team consisted of Partners Raluca Nastase, Sorin Aungurenci, and Ruxandra Jianu, Senior Associate Anca Zegrean, and Associates Radu Jianu and Kira Bujduveanu.
